首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Cordova JS文件-未捕获引用错误

是指在使用Cordova框架进行移动应用开发时,出现了未捕获的引用错误。Cordova是一个开源的移动应用开发框架,可以使用HTML、CSS和JavaScript等前端技术进行跨平台应用的开发。

在Cordova开发中,通常会使用一些插件来扩展应用的功能,这些插件通常是以JavaScript文件的形式提供。当在应用中引用这些插件时,如果出现了未捕获的引用错误,意味着应用无法正确加载或使用相关插件,导致应用功能受限或出现异常。

解决Cordova JS文件-未捕获引用错误的方法通常包括以下几个步骤:

  1. 确认插件是否正确安装:首先,需要确认所使用的插件是否已经正确安装到应用中。可以通过查看插件的文档或官方网站来了解正确的安装步骤。
  2. 检查引用路径是否正确:确保在应用的HTML文件中正确引用了相关的JavaScript文件。可以通过检查文件路径、文件名和文件扩展名等来确认引用路径是否正确。
  3. 检查插件版本兼容性:有时,未捕获引用错误可能是由于插件版本与Cordova框架版本不兼容所致。在使用插件之前,建议查看插件的文档或官方网站,确认插件的兼容性信息,并选择与当前Cordova版本兼容的插件版本。
  4. 检查依赖关系:某些插件可能依赖于其他插件或库文件。在使用插件之前,需要确保相关的依赖关系已经正确配置和安装。
  5. 调试和错误处理:如果以上步骤都没有解决问题,可以尝试使用调试工具来定位错误。可以使用浏览器的开发者工具或Cordova提供的调试工具来查看错误信息、堆栈跟踪等,以便更好地理解和解决问题。

对于Cordova开发中的未捕获引用错误,腾讯云提供了一些相关产品和服务,例如:

  1. 云开发(https://cloud.tencent.com/product/tcb):腾讯云提供的一站式后端云服务,可以帮助开发者快速搭建和部署移动应用的后端服务,包括数据库、存储、云函数等功能,方便开发者集中精力进行前端开发。
  2. 云函数(https://cloud.tencent.com/product/scf):腾讯云的无服务器计算服务,可以帮助开发者将业务逻辑以函数的形式部署和运行,提供了与Cordova开发相结合的灵活性和扩展性。

以上是关于Cordova JS文件-未捕获引用错误的解释和解决方法,希望对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何处理 Node.js 中出现的捕获异常?

Node.js 程序运行在单进程上,应用开发时一个难免遇到的问题就是异常处理,对于一些捕获的异常处理起来,也不是一件容易的事情。...进程崩溃优雅退出 关于错误捕获,Node.js 官网曾提供了一个模块 domain 来实现,但是现在已废弃了所以就不再考虑了。...实现一个 graceful.js 实现一个 graceful 函数,初始化加载时注册 uncaughtException、unhandledRejection 两个错误事件,分别监听捕获错误信息和捕获的...throwCount.unhandledRejection > 1) return; handleError(options); } HandleError 方法为核心实现,首先遍历应用传入的 servers,监听 request 事件,在捕获错误触发之后...这一次,即使右侧 /error 路由产生捕获异常,也将不会引起左侧请求无法正常响应。

2.9K30
  • 使用 Cordova 构建应用的流程

    应用程序本身实现为一个 web 页面,默认情况下是一个名为 index.html 的本地文件,该文件引用 CSS、 JavaScript、图片、媒体文件或其他运行所必需的资源。...cordova-plugin-wechat 一个 cordova 插件,一个微信 SDK 的 JS 版本 cordova-plugin-zip 一个 Cordova 插件解压缩文件在安卓和 iOS。...传递给exec的成功回调只是对 window.echo 回调函数的引用。 如果本地平台触发错误回调,它只需调用成功回调并将其传递为默认字符串。 5....当捕获异常并返回错误时,为了清晰起见,尽可能使返回到 JavaScript 的错误匹配 Java 的异常名称是很重要的。...这种方法只有在你确定没有其他插件会依赖于你引用的库(例如,如果库是特定于你的插件的)的情况下才能使用。 否则,如果另一个插件添加了相同的库,就有可能导致你的插件用户出现构建错误

    4.3K11

    html(css、js、html、web)文件引用路径写法【flask】

    文件: 比如文件路径:static/css/pintuer.css,路径如下: 2、引用网上css、js文件 如cdn加速资源 常规路径 <link rel="stylesheet" type="text/css" href="http://...代码中对templates模板的<em>引用</em> 路径:实际的路由 以<em>js</em><em>文件</em>中配置templates/404.html为例, //<em>js</em> { "title" : "css", "icon" : "...文件中对templates模板的引用 参照4 6、js文件中对其他内嵌js文件引用 以layui内置为例,在index.js 引入 bodyTab.js bodyTab.js 项目路径:/static...如果数据库涉及文件存放路径,更换电脑后原本正常的项目显示static文件路径构建失败的情况,记得先检查下数据库存储的路径是否有问题。

    3.9K30

    iOS下JS与OC互相调用(八)--Cordova详解+实战

    这里添加config.xml 、Private 和 Public 两个文件夹里的所有文件。工程目录结构如下: ? 然后运行工程,? ? ? ,你会发现报了一堆的错误: ? 为什么有会这么多报错呢?...不用急,这里报错是因为Cordova的类引用错误,在命令行创建的工程里Cordova 是以子工程的形式加入到目标工程中,两个工程的命名空间不同,所以import 是用 类似这样的方式#import <Cordova...其他的文件引用报错同理。 当然,如果想偷懒,也可以从后面我给的示例工程里拷贝,我修改过的Cordova库。...** 加载本地HTML ** 加载本地HTML,为了方便起见,首先新建一个叫www的文件夹,然后在文件夹里放入要加载的HTML和cordova.js。...首先,HTML中需要加载 cordova.js,需要注意该js 文件的路径,因为我的cordova.js与HTML放在同一个文件夹,所以src 是这样写: <script type="text/javascript

    2.7K20

    给Ionic写一个cordova(PhoneGap)插件

    这个需求的难点在于需要访问手机的内存读取安装包文件,如果是普通的需求就可以一个html、一个JS(controller)外加上路由配置就 so easy~   首先一个规范的cordova插件是这样子的...cordova命令用的,请不要忽略~ plugin.xml:这个文件里面是以xml的形式定义了包的路径以及api(js)对应原生的调用方法......调用方法时传的参数,均以json的形式读入(这里使用) * callbackContext:方法返回的对象,对象里面包好两个变量success和error,js的回调函数会用到...(success, fail, "ApkValidatePlugin", command, []);//参数(回调成功,回调错误,别名,action名称,参数) 11 }; 12 var apkValidate...src="www/apkValidatePlugin.js"> 15 16 17

    1.4K40

    给Ionic写一个cordova(PhoneGap)插件

    这个需求的难点在于需要访问手机的内存读取安装包文件,如果是普通的需求就可以一个html、一个JS(controller)外加上路由配置就 so easy~   首先一个规范的cordova插件是这样子的...cordova命令用的,请不要忽略~ plugin.xml:这个文件里面是以xml的形式定义了包的路径以及api(js)对应原生的调用方法......调用方法时传的参数,均以json的形式读入(这里使用) * callbackContext:方法返回的对象,对象里面包好两个变量success和error,js的回调函数会用到...(success, fail, "ApkValidatePlugin", command, []);//参数(回调成功,回调错误,别名,action名称,参数) 11 }; 12 var apkValidate...src="www/apkValidatePlugin.js"> 15 16 17

    1.9K100

    Cordova封装打包vue H5项目到Android平台详解

    android@6.2.3 成功之后如下: [在这里插入图片描述] 输入cordova platform ls可查看已安装的平台情况 [在这里插入图片描述] 此时项目文件夹已经有了platform文件夹了...index文件复制到cordova项目的www文件夹中 [在这里插入图片描述] 这里面很多教程都说直接复制粘贴其实不是的!...要在index.html中引入cordova.js,不然后续所有的插件都不能使用!...所有需要的环境我放在这大家自行下载即可 运行项目生成apk包 cordova build android 首次编译需要一段时间,如果报网络错误请切换网络重试 [在这里插入图片描述] 这里生成的debug...接下来就是把生成的证书和上一步生成的签名的正式的apk包放同一个文件夹 然后再该文件夹下执行 jarsigner -verbose -keystore XXX.keystore -signedjar

    1.8K50

    Cordova封装打包vue H5项目到Android平台详解

    android@6.2.3 成功之后如下: [在这里插入图片描述] 输入cordova platform ls可查看已安装的平台情况 [在这里插入图片描述] 此时项目文件夹已经有了platform文件夹了...index文件复制到cordova项目的www文件夹中 [在这里插入图片描述] 这里面很多教程都说直接复制粘贴其实不是的!...要在index.html中引入cordova.js,不然后续所有的插件都不能使用!...所有需要的环境我放在这大家自行下载即可 运行项目生成apk包 cordova build android 首次编译需要一段时间,如果报网络错误请切换网络重试 [在这里插入图片描述] 这里生成的debug...接下来就是把生成的证书和上一步生成的签名的正式的apk包放同一个文件夹 然后再该文件夹下执行 jarsigner -verbose -keystore XXX.keystore -signedjar

    1.6K206

    Cordova插件cordova-plugin-media-capture实现短视频的录制上传和播放

    2、拍摄的视频上传至服务器 3、服务端接收视频文件并转码保存删除源文件,将保存链接返回给客户端 4、客户端接收链接利用vedio插件进行显示播放 实现步骤 安装cordova-plugin-media-capture...安装cordova-plugin-file-transfer cordova plugin add cordova-plugin-file-transfer 上传文件至服务器 上传方法 //fileURL...vedioData; $this->response($this->res,'json'); }else{ $this->res['code'] = 101; $this->res['msg'] = '转码错误请重试...入口文件中引入: import VideoPlayer from 'vue-video-player' require('video.js/dist/video-js.css') require('vue-video-player...由于项目中很多地方可能涉及到引用的本地的一些icon文件导致你们复制粘贴后不能正常运行,所以将此视频上传封装成了一个组件方便大家在项目中直接引用 这里直接将源文件和icon图片资源上传供大家下载查看完整的

    1.8K00

    毕业设计So Easy:Java MySQL智能报纸阅读器APP应用

    3、开发环境搭建 本项目需要安装 Android 开发环境以及 Cordova 框架。下面将分为 JDK、Android SDK、Node.jsCordova 4个部分进行讲解。...这里选择的是 Node.js for Mac的安装文件进行下载,下载完成后双击下载文件即可自动开始安装。安装完成后在终端中输入 node -v 即可显示当前 Node.js 的安装版本号。...在WebStorm中打开SmartReader文件夹,即可看到该目录下已经生成了一系列的代码文件。  完成创建 Cordova工程。...Cordova会在www目录下默认生成index.html,css/index.css,img/logo.png和js/index.js文件。...然后即可引用: 5.2、数据存储 HTML5提供了两种在客户端存储数据的新方法,分别是

    51620
    领券